Transaction 66ad0c59c7503bf75bcebef143215f2786cf7aaf72ec5a8412a2db228f821efb
2 Input
2 Outputs
- 66ad0c59c7503bf75bcebef143215f2786cf7aaf72ec5a8412a2db228f821efb:0
- 66ad0c59c7503bf75bcebef143215f2786cf7aaf72ec5a8412a2db228f821efb:1
value 249990000
address 1EAp3dUgRWR2K9G2ryQHPeQygjh4C5ed32
value 10582206
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8